RETURNED SOLDIERS' ASSOCIATION.

• CLAIMS PRESSED. ON MINISTER, By Telegraph.—Presi Association. '. Wellington, Last Night. ' ' The Returned Soldiers' Association, Ik the course of its statement to Kir Junn Allen, presses for the immediate settle* meat of the retrospective application to children of the amended scale of allowance which came into force on January 1, 1918; also the restrospectlve application of the amended scale of allowances for widowed mothers and dependent* at present in force; the payment of oa« shilling a day, unpaid daring the flret two years of the war, for the probation ary period of a month after entenwf camp. . j i The statement concludes: "We claim .1 these are honorable and just debt* in. \ curred by a rich and prosperous country \ toward the dependents of those who, by ' '.- their valor and suffering, have saved her the humiliation and ruination of defeat, and should be at once honored.' i
